Somedays, things get so busy before the holidays that it feels like Capitola Girl is traveling through the day on an endless spiral. Work suddenly picks up with projects needing to be completed before the holidays, friends start popping by, parties need to be planned...At the end of the day, all the excitement makes Capitola Girl feel pretty crazy, because she has so many things to do besides beading. But instead of getting dizzy, Capitola Girl reminds herself at the end of the day she can craft a necklace that imitates and relaxes her day. This spiral is a choker length necklace created from lapis and pearls. Lapis is a rock, not a mineral and it was used during the Middle Ages as symbol that protected from error and fear.
